    Highlights:
    Okinawa is located in the southeast corner of the Japanese archipelago. It consists of 160 islands and has clear waters, rich marine life and unique seabed topography, attracting many diving enthusiasts to explore. Unique Creatures and Landscapes:Okinawa's waters are famous for their rich marine life, which is nurtured by the warm waters and varied geographical environment. Clownfish, sea turtles, tropical fish, white-tip sharks, and humpback whales make divers feel like they are in a fairytale world under the sea. Okinawa also has world-class soft coral reefs, which are not only colorful and diverse, but also form a unique underwater landscape. Excellent Visibility: The water transparency of Okinawa is extremely high, with visibility of 25-35 meters. The clear water allows divers to clearly see every corner of the seabed and enjoy the charm of coral reefs and marine life. Comfortable air and water temperature:Okinawa has a subtropical climate,The best diving season in Okinawa is from June to October. During this period, there is plenty of sunshine and the sea water is warm, which is very suitable for diving. Beginner Difficulty: Diving in Okinawa is relatively easy. The depth of the diving spot is usually 15-25 meters. The current is weak and there is no pressure even with the top current. Okinawa diving has become an ideal choice for diving enthusiasts with its unique underwater ecology, high transparency and suitable climatic conditions. Whether you are a novice or an experienced diver, you can find your own underwater paradise here.

    Highlights:
    The Taiko performance in Okinawa Prefecture, namely EISA Taiko, is an important part of Ryukyu's traditional culture and originated from the sacrificial activities of the Bon Festival. In the performance, the passionate drums are combined with brave dances to show a unique artistic charm. EISA Taiko is divided into large and small Taiko, and the drummers play according to the size of the drums to form a rich sound effect. There are many Taiko performances in Okinawa Prefecture, such as the 1,000-person Taiko performance in Kokusai-dori, the daily performances in Ryukyu Village, and the EISA Taiko Festival across the island of Okinawa, which attract many tourists and local residents. These performances not only represent the Okinawan people's respect and remembrance for their ancestors, but also become a cultural resource link connecting people inside and outside Okinawa. Through Taiko performances, people can deeply feel the unique charm and profound heritage of Okinawa's traditional culture.
